TPWallet最新版设置滑点12的核心价值,在于把“交易成功率”和“价格波动风险”做出可计算的平衡。对于链上交换类操作,滑点本质是允许执行价格偏离预期的容差;当流动性变化或路由聚合导致价格跳动时,滑点越小越可能失败,越大越可能成交但成本更高。要做到既稳又快,需要工程化与策略化的推理:第一,交易前应结合池深度、预估成交量与历史波动幅度;第二,采用动态路由与合约调用时的参数校验;第三,配合实时行情监控来决定是否“继续下单”。
一、防缓冲区溢出:从工程安全角度理解“交易稳定性”。链上交互常涉及字节编码与合约输入构造,若在客户端或路由计算中存在长度未校验、边界条件缺失,就可能引发缓冲区溢出或内存越界风险,最终导致交易构建错误、拒绝签名或异常回滚。安全研究普遍强调:对外部输入做严格长度与范围校验、使用安全的序列化方法、对关键缓冲区进行边界保护是降低漏洞的基础。权威参考可对照 OWASP 的 Web/接口安全原则(如输入验证与安全编码)以及 Solidity 相关安全实践(如社区对越界与溢出风险的系统性归纳)。在“滑点12”的策略中,虽然这是交易容差,但其前提依赖可靠的数据封装与参数校验,否则再合理的滑点也无法救回错误的路由与金额。
二、合约同步:为什么要“同步”而不是“照单执行”。合约同步指的是在发起交换前,确保合约状态、价格预估所用的区块数据与路由计算来源一致。若客户端使用的行情/池状态落后于当前区块,预估价格会失真,滑点容差需要被动放大,带来成本上升甚至成交偏离预期。工程上通常通过监听新块、在同一会话内保持数据一致性、对关键参数做二次校验来实现同步。以以太坊与 EVM 生态的最佳实践来看,任何基于状态的估价都应面向“当前块”的读操作,并在交易发送前尽量减少状态漂移。
三、专家解答剖析:滑点12并非“越大越好”。从交易执行机理出发,滑点12可以视作“成交保险”。但保险的保费取决于真实市场冲击与手续费结构。专家通常建议:在流动性充足、价格波动低时,滑点可取更保守;在快速波动或低深度池,滑点要结合路由与预估滑移动态调整。对 TPWallet 的最新版使用体验而言,关键在于让用户把“12”与“当下行情”绑定:当实时监控发现短时价差扩大、成交量放大或买卖盘不平衡,滑点可以维持或上调;反之则降低。
四、高效能市场支付应用:滑点与速度的协同。面向支付场景(例如聚合路由的商户收款、分发转账、自动换币结算),最怕的是“失败重试”造成的手续费累积与链上排队成本。高效能支付的策略是:用实时行情监控做前置判断,用合约同步减少估价偏差,用安全编码避免交易构建异常;同时用合理滑点提高一次成交率。这样能把成功率提升转化为真实成本下降。
五、实时行情监控与代币新闻:让决策有“证据”。建议将实时行情(价格、深度、滑移预估、成交量)与代币新闻(合约升级、分红/销毁、重大公告、交易所变动)联动。权威信息通常来自项目官方渠道、监管/公告披露与信誉良好的数据聚合源。将新闻事件映射到“可能的波动方向与强度”,再决定滑点区间与下单时机,能显著提升策略的可解释性与稳定性。
权威文献提示:可参考 OWASP 关于输入验证与安全编码的通用指南,以及 Solidity/EVM 安全实践中对溢出与边界检查的总结;同时结合以太坊官方文档对区块状态与读写一致性的说明,形成“同步—估价—执行—校验”的闭环推理框架。
——
互动投票问题(请选或投票):
1)你更看重交易“成交率”还是“成本更低”?


2)在你常用的交易里,滑点12算偏保守还是偏激进?
3)你是否愿意用“实时行情+新闻”来动态调整滑点?
4)你遇到过因为状态不同步导致的滑点失效/成交异常吗?
FQA:
Q1:滑点12是否适用于所有代币?
A:不一定。不同流动性与波动水平需要不同容差,建议结合深度与滑移预估动态设置。
Q2:合约同步具体怎么影响执行?
A:估价若基于过期状态会失真,滑点需要补偿;同步能减少偏差,提高执行一致性。
Q3:如何降低“交易构建异常”风险?
A:通过严格输入校验、安全编码与参数边界检查,避免错误编码导致失败或回滚。
评论
LunaTrader
把滑点12讲成“成交保险费率”,思路很清晰;合约同步那段对我很有启发。
晨雾AI
实时行情+代币新闻联动这个方向很实用,尤其是遇到突然波动时。
KaiWei
防缓冲区溢出用来解释客户端可靠性,虽然偏工程但确实能落到交易稳定。
NovaX
文章推理链闭环做得好:同步→估价→执行→校验。希望能再给参数示例。
墨岚
我以前只盯成交价,没考虑状态漂移导致的滑点偏离,涨知识了。